Do Mezzanine Floors Require Disabled Access?

Part M of the Building Regulations addresses the subject of disabled access. Mezzanines that are generally utilised for storage will not typically require disabled access. Other applications for mezzanines, such as offices, cafeterias, and so on, may necessitate disability access, depending on the architecture of your building or the requirements of your Local Authority/Approved Inspector.

Do I Need Planning Permission For Mezzanine Floor Installation?

If the mezzanine is completely demountable and the improvements are internal, you will almost always not need Planning Permission. However, Building Regulations Approval is required.

What are the sizing restrictions?

The size, shape, and height of the new mezzanine floor are not restricted by building codes. The government, on the other hand, has been attempting to curb the spread of retail space in out-of-town buildings by enacting legislation requiring planning clearance for floors larger than 200 square metres. However, you can add additional levels of less than 200 square metres without obtaining planning clearance.

What additional costs could be involved?

You need to consider fire protection, emergency lighting, smoke and fire alarms and relevant safety signage.
